Job summary

University of North Texas at Dallas seeks a Director of Development to plan and execute fundraising strategies, building relationships with individual, corporate and foundation donors. You will coordinate donor cultivation, solicitation, and stewardship activities in partnership with university leadership, advancing UNT Dallas priorities.

The role requires a Bachelor's degree and seven years of fundraising leadership experience, with strong communication and strategic planning skills.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in related field and seven (7) years of professional related experience in managing, directing, and initiating fundraising or related field.

Responsibilities

  • Manage a portfolio of individual and family foundation prospects capable of making significant gifts to UNT Dallas.
  • Identify, qualify, cultivate, solicit and steward donors and prospective donors through personal visits and proposals.
  • Develop individualized cultivation and solicitation strategies aligned with donor interests and university priorities.
  • Coordinate with university leadership to plan targeted outreach to expand the donor pipeline.
